In the world of digital media, image formats play a crucial role in determining the quality and size of images displayed on websites and other digital platforms. One popular image format that is commonly used is PNG (Portable Network Graphics). However, in recent years, a new image format called WebP has emerged as a more efficient and versatile alternative to PNG. In this article, we will explore the benefits of converting PNG images to WebP and how to do so effectively.
WebP is a modern image format developed by Google that offers superior image quality and smaller file sizes compared to traditional formats like PNG and JPEG. WebP uses advanced compression techniques such as lossless and lossy compression to reduce the size of images without compromising on quality. This makes WebP ideal for optimizing website performance and improving user experience by reducing load times and bandwidth usage.
One of the main benefits of converting PNG images to WebP is the reduction in file size, which can lead to faster loading times for websites and applications. This is especially important in today’s fast-paced digital landscape, where users expect websites to load quickly and seamlessly. By converting PNG images to WebP, website owners can significantly improve the performance of their sites and provide a better user experience for their visitors.
Another advantage of using WebP over PNG is its support for advanced features such as transparency and animation. WebP supports both lossless and lossy transparency, allowing developers to create visually stunning images with smooth transitions and gradients. Additionally, WebP supports animated images, making it a versatile format for creating interactive and engaging content on websites and applications.
So, how can you convert PNG images to WebP? There are several tools and software available that can help you easily convert PNG images to WebP format. One popular tool is the Google WebP Converter, which is a simple and user-friendly tool that allows you to convert PNG images to WebP with just a few clicks. To use the Google WebP Converter, simply upload your PNG images to the tool, select the desired compression settings, and click “Convert” to generate WebP images.
Another option for converting PNG images to WebP is using command-line tools such as cwebp or ImageMagick. These tools provide more advanced features and customization options for converting images to WebP format. For example, you can specify the compression level, quality settings, and other parameters to optimize the conversion process and achieve the desired results.
When converting PNG images to WebP, it is important to consider the trade-offs between image quality and file size. While WebP offers superior compression efficiency, you may need to adjust the compression settings to balance image quality and file size based on your specific requirements. It is recommended to test different compression settings and compare the results to find the optimal balance between quality and size for your images.
